Description Ref # 56825

Length: 4 1/2"
Ring Gauge: 46
Strength: Medium - Full
Packaging: Tin of 4 Cigars

Format: Belicoso
Provenance: Dominican Republic
Enjoyment Time: 20 mins

WINSTON CHURCHILL
There is only one Winston Churchill and only one cigar that can do justice to the man. Davidoff Winston Churchill cigars present a blend as complex as the man himself.

BELICOSO
Throughout his life Sir Winston was a traveller, a wayfarer, exploring the world through his work as a war correspondent, widening his horizons and his mind. This took him to Cuba and to the beginning of his love affair with cigars. Indeed seeds from the island are in the fabric of the Belicoso. Later, his roaming spirit would take him to Marrakesh, the inspiration for many of his paintings and a location as rich and full-flavoured as this Belicoso format cigar, which would certainly satisfy Sir Winston’s taste for the exotic.

Tasting Notes

Leather and roasted almonds followed by a creamy aftertaste.

by GENEVIEVE on Saturday 02 April, 2022
Having enjoyed other Davidoff cigars previously, I am pleased to say this cigar did not disappoint and is my favourite Davidoff to date. This consistently filled cigar is very well made, with a robust, uniform wrapper, easy draw and only required re-lighting once it was smoked down to the band...I enjoyed this cigar so much I just had to have those extra few puffs down to the nub. The ash also held to a good inch before departing and the burn was consistent throughout, creating plumes of deliciously creamy smoke that wasnt too hot or too strong whilst remaining flavourful. The main flavours I experienced were a lot of toasted almond, some slightly burnt caramel and moving into the middle of the cigar, a few coffee notes ending up with an almost cocoa type edge towards the end. Low on pepperiness (a good thing IMO) and a very pleasurable way to spend around 45 minutes with a coffee on a Saturday afternoon. Mild enough for an afternoon smoke but mid-strength enough for an after-dinner treat too - lovely!
